Characterizing the astrometric precision limit for moving targets observed with digital-array detectors

Aims. We investigate the maximum astrometric precision that can be reached on moving targets observed with digital-sensor arrays, and provide an estimate for its ultimate lower limit based on the Cram\'er-Rao bound. Methods. We extend previous work on one-dimensional Gaussian point-spread funct...
